What is Metaphysical poem?

The term "Metaphysical" when applied to poetry has long and interesting history. Metaphysical poetry is highly intellectual ,highly imagery, complexity and subtlety of thought, sometime use paradox and often by deliberate harshness or rigidity of expression.
  Here some notable poets who was master to write Metaphysical poems.
1) John Donne
2) George Herbert
3) Richard Crashaw
4) Andrew Marvell
5) Henry Vaughan
 
Metaphysical poetry 's characteristics :

1) They wanted to distinguish themselves from the Elizabethan age and so they used difficult language in their poems.
2)Far fetched images are most important feature of Metaphysical poetry. They need their image from different field like biology, science,agriculture and engineering. For example The Flea in this poem ,poet chosen mosquito biological from through expressed love.Here the poem Flea one stanza its example of biologically image use

Mark but this flea, and mark in this,   
How little that which thou deniest me is;   
It sucked me first, and now sucks thee,
And in this flea our two bloods mingled be;   
Thou know’st that this cannot be said
A sin, nor shame, nor loss of maidenhead,
   
   
2) Complex sentence patterns : words are easy to understand , but ideas are more difficult to grasp. Its example is Pulley poem written by George Herbert and other is And "To His Coy Mistress" poem written by Andrew Marvell. Here pulley poem is best example

3) Philosophical themes :- down to earth Philosophical approach.
